
The housekeeping industry. Housekeepers are under such tight time restraints (30 min per room) and given like 15 rooms to clean in 8 hrs that they are forced to cut corners. Never trust the coffee pot, towels, bedding (the duvet is never changed only if there’s a strain on it or it smells really bad or something), don’t trust the glasses, and don’t walk around barefoot. I’ve seen housekeepers using the toilet brush to clean the bathtub. And touching the clean towers after touching the toilet. Unfortunately there’s not enough time to really clean so we give the illusion of a clean room. Management only cares that the metal is shiny with no water spots, there’s no hair anywhere, and everything is in its place and looks organized. But really it’s gross!
